Data validation implementation within cryptocurrency, options, and derivatives relies heavily on algorithmic checks to ensure data integrity across disparate systems. These algorithms verify the accuracy, consistency, and completeness of market data feeds, trade executions, and position calculations, mitigating systemic risk. Sophisticated implementations incorporate anomaly detection, utilizing statistical methods to identify outliers indicative of errors or malicious activity, crucial for maintaining fair pricing and order execution. The precision of these algorithms directly impacts the reliability of risk models and the overall stability of trading operations, demanding continuous refinement and backtesting.
Compliance
Data validation implementation is fundamentally linked to regulatory compliance, particularly concerning reporting requirements and preventing market manipulation in financial derivatives. Exchanges and trading platforms must demonstrate robust validation processes to adhere to standards set by governing bodies, ensuring transparency and accountability. This includes validating counterparty information, trade details, and reporting data against established rules and regulations, minimizing legal and reputational risks. Effective implementation necessitates audit trails and documentation to demonstrate adherence to compliance frameworks, a critical aspect of operational resilience.
Calculation
Accurate calculation forms the core of data validation implementation, especially in the pricing and risk assessment of complex derivatives. Validation processes confirm the correctness of pricing models, Greeks, and exposure calculations, preventing erroneous trades and inaccurate risk reporting. This involves verifying the inputs to these calculations, such as interest rates, volatility surfaces, and underlying asset prices, against independent sources. The integrity of these calculations is paramount for informed decision-making and effective risk management, demanding rigorous testing and independent verification.
